Question Deadline: May 28, 2026 Legislative Appropriations #L0047 Question Deadline 05/28/2026 Any questions are to be submitted via email to jeffrey.antonacci@ice-eng.com This project includes the deep well drilling and installation of all mechanical equipment needed for a new potable water well to supplement the existing potable water supply. The proposed project will replace existing Potable Water Well No. 1 with a proposed new Potable Water Well No. 1R in the City of Hampton, FL. The method of Contractor Selection has not been Determined at this time. Project Site (Site): Owner's Water Yard, 10019 S. Florida Avenue, Hampton, Florida A. This Project includes the abandonment and replacement of the Owner's existing Well No. 1, situated within the Water Yard. The existing well is constructed with an 8-inch casing, reportedly extending to a depth of 136 feet below land surface (bls), with a total well depth of 192 feet bls. Abandonment of the existing well shall be performed in accordance with Section 02670, Water wells, and as detailed below. B. Existing Well No. 1 Abandonment Procedures: 1. The Contractor shall obtain all necessary well abandonment permits from the Suwannee River Water Management District (SRWMD) and any other applicable regulatory authorities. The Contractor is responsible for all associated fees and submittal of required documentation. 2. Mobilize the abandonment rig and all necessary equipment to the designated Site. 3. Remove any protective coverings and insert a tremie pipe to the bottom of the well to verify total depth prior to abandonment. If substantial backfill or debris is present, the Contractor shall clean the borehole to restore its original depth. 4. Perform well abandonment activities in accordance with Section 02670, Water Wells. 5. Place pea gravel from the bottom of the borehole up to a point 10 feet below the base of the 8-inch casing. Grout shall then be pumped from the top of the pea gravel to the land surface using the tremie method, in accordance with Section 02670, Water Wells. 6. Cut the 8-inch casing to a minimum depth of 3 feet below finished grade. . Demolish, remove, and properly dispose of the existing concrete well pad. C. The replacement well shall be installed on City-owned property approximately 150 feet east of the existing well location, as depicted in Figure 1 of Section 02670, Water Wells. The Contractor shall construct one (1) replacement well completed in the upper Floridan aquifer, in accordance with Section 02670, Water Wells. Construction shall include installation of an 18-inch surface casing to a depth of approximately 70 feet bls, followed by a 12-inch final casing to a depth of approximately 150 feet bls. The open borehole interval shall be drilled to a depth of approximately 275 feet bls, or as otherwise directed by the Engineer. The Contractor shall be responsible for both construction and performance testing of the replacement well as outlined below. D. Upper Floridan Aquifer Replacement Well Construction and Testing Sequence: 1. The Contractor shall be responsible for obtaining the well construction permits from the SRWMD and other regulatory agencies prior to starting well construction activities. 2. Clear the Site as necessary to facilitate access and accommodate well construction operations. 3. Install temporary silt fencing to mitigate erosion and prevent silt migration throughout construction and testing activities. 4. Commence construction of the upper Floridan aquifer well by drilling an 8-inch pilot hole from land surface to a depth of 70 feet bls, in accordance with Section 02670, Water Wells. 5. Collect lithologic samples in accordance with Section 02670, Water Wells. 6. Ream the pilot hole to a nominal 24-inch diameter and install approximately 70 feet of 18-inch surface casing. Grout the surface casing in accordance with Section 02670, Water Wells. 7. Drill an 8-inch pilot hole from the base of the installed surface casing to a total depth of 275 feet bls. Collect lithologic samples per Section 02670, Water Wells. 8. Ream pilot hole to a nominal 18-inch borehole and install approximately 150 feet of 12-inch final casing. Grout the final casing in accordance with Section 02670, Water Wells. 9. Drill a nominal 12-inch borehole from the base of the 12-inch final casing to a depth of approximately 275 feet bls using reverse-air rotary methods. Collect both reverse-air water quality samples and lithologic samples in accordance with Section 02670, Water Wells. 10. Conduct short-term air-lift drill stem capacity tests during reverse-air drilling operations, as specified in Section 02670, Water Wells 11. Develop the well in accordance with Section 02670, Water Wells. 12. With the borehole drilled to 275 feet bls, install a test pump and conduct an 8-hour step drawdown pumping test in accordance with Section 02672, Well Pumping Test. JOB FILE No.: 2025087
